🔍 What is Trezor?
Trezor is a hardware wallet that allows you to store, send, and receive cryptocurrency securely. Unlike online wallets, Trezor stores your private keys offline, protecting your assets from online attacks. It supports over 1000 c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, Ethereum, Litecoin, and more.
Trezor is developed by SatoshiLabs, a trusted name in crypto security.

🛠️ Step-by-Step Login and Setup Process
✅ Step 1: Unbox and Connect Your Device
Take your Trezor Model One or Model T out of the box. Connect it to your computer using the USB cable that came with it. If you're using a mobile device, use a compatible OTG cable.
✅ Step 2: Choose Your Device on Trezor.io/start
After visiting the setup page, you’ll be asked to select your device model. Click on the correct model to continue.
✅ Step 3: Install Trezor Bridge or Suite
Depending on your system, you’ll be prompted to install Trezor Bridge (a communication tool) or download the Trezor Suite desktop app. These tools help your computer and Trezor device communicate safely.
Follow the on-screen instructions to install the necessary software.
✅ Step 4: Update Firmware
If your Trezor device is brand new, it may not have the latest firmware. Trezor.io/start will prompt you to install the newest firmware version. This ensures your wallet has the latest security patches and features.
Click “Install Firmware” and wait for the update to complete.
✅ Step 5: Create a New Wallet
Once your device is ready, choose the option “Create a New Wallet.” Your Trezor will generate a recovery seed—a list of 12 or 24 random words.
📝 Important: Write these words down on paper and store them securely offline. Do not save them digitally or take a photo.
✅ Step 6: Set a PIN
Now it’s time to choose a secure PIN code. This adds another layer of protection to your device. Use a number that’s hard to guess and keep it confidential.
✅ Step 7: Access Your Wallet via Trezor Suite
Once everything is set, you'll be directed to the Trezor Suite interface. From here, you can:
- Check your crypto balance
- Send and receive funds
- Manage multiple wallets
- Swap or exchange crypto
- Monitor market prices

❓ Frequently Asked Questions
Q1: What if I lose my recovery phrase?
Without your seed phrase, there's no way to recover your wallet or funds. Always back it up safely.
Q2: Can I recover my wallet on a new device?
Yes! Simply choose “Recover Wallet” on the new device and enter your original seed phrase.
Q3: Is Trezor better than a hot wallet?
Yes. Trezor offers offline protection, making it much harder for hackers to steal your assets.
